Advertisement

Django与Vue结合的项目文件.zip

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本资源包包含一个使用Python Django框架作为后端和Vue.js作为前端的完整项目文件。适合希望学习如何将前后端分离技术整合到实际应用中的开发者。 django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zipdjango_project_django_vue_project_zip

全部评论 (0)

还没有任何评论哟~
客服
客服
  • DjangoVue.zip
    优质
    本资源包包含一个使用Python Django框架作为后端和Vue.js作为前端的完整项目文件。适合希望学习如何将前后端分离技术整合到实际应用中的开发者。 django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zip django项目 django+vue项目.zipdjango_project_django_vue_project_zip
  • DjangoVue前后端
    优质
    本项目致力于探索并实现Django后端框架与Vue前端框架的有效集成,旨在构建高效、响应式的Web应用程序。通过结合Python的Django和JavaScript的Vue,开发者能够充分利用两者的优点,为用户提供更加流畅的交互体验。 在构建一个前后端分离的项目时,可以采用Django作为后端框架来处理业务逻辑、数据库操作以及API接口开发,并使用Vue.js作为前端框架进行视图渲染与用户交互设计。这种组合能够充分发挥各自技术栈的优势:Django提供了强大的模型-视图-模板(MVT)架构及ORM支持;而Vue则以其组件化特性为项目带来了更好的可维护性和扩展性。 为了实现前后端分离,通常会采用RESTful API的方式进行数据交换。后端通过定义清晰的API接口供前端调用,同时确保跨域资源共享(CORS)配置正确以解决不同服务器之间的访问问题。在开发过程中还可以利用Django REST Framework这样的第三方库来简化接口的设计与文档生成。 前端方面,则需要根据业务需求设计合理的页面布局及交互流程,并结合Vue Router实现单页应用(SPA)的导航功能,同时借助Vuex管理全局状态共享机制以提高代码复用率。此外,在项目部署阶段还需考虑静态文件托管、服务器端渲染(SSR)等技术方案的选择。 总之,通过合理规划与设计,采用Django和Vue相结合的技术栈能够有效提升开发效率及用户体验质量。
  • djangopymysql学生代码.zip
    优质
    本资源包含使用Django框架和PyMySQL库开发的学生管理项目的源代码。适合学习后端Web开发及数据库操作技术。 使用Django和PyMySQL编写的student项目是为了练习。
  • PythonVueDjango前后端分离实践
    优质
    本项目通过Python搭配Vue与Django技术栈实现前后端分离开发,展示现代Web应用构建流程及优化技巧。 本课程注重实战,在项目情境下拆解基础知识的学习方式能够保持学习兴趣并充满动力,让你时刻了解所学知识的实际应用价值。 一、融会贯通 本视频采用前后端分离的开发模式:前端使用Vue.js与Element UI实现Web页面展示;后端则通过Python的Django框架构建数据访问接口。前端运用Axios技术来调用后端的数据接口,完成信息获取。学完这一章节之后,你将真正理解前后两端各自的功能和职责。 二、贴近实战 本课程以学生管理系统v4.0开发项目为实例进行讲解,涵盖以下内容:项目的整体介绍;基本功能的演示;Vuejs框架初始化过程;Element UI组件库的应用方法;在Django中实现数据增删改查接口的技术细节;前端通过Vuejs调用这些API完成相应的操作等。所有知识点都以实战演练的形式呈现。 三、课程亮点 本案例最大的特色在于实现了前后端的分离,使你能够清晰地理解两者的功能分工以及交互方式。
  • DjangoVue问卷系统
    优质
    本项目是一款基于Python Django框架和前端Vue技术构建的高效问卷调查系统,旨在为用户提供便捷、灵活且功能强大的在线问卷创建及管理工具。 【Django+Vue问卷系统】是一种基于Django后端框架和Vue.js前端框架构建的在线问卷调查平台。这个项目旨在实现类似问卷星、腾讯问卷的核心功能,尽管可能在题型多样性上有所简化,但仍然能够提供基本的问卷设计、发布、收集及分析服务。 **Django** 是一个用Python编写的高级Web框架,它鼓励快速开发和实用主义设计。在本项目中,Django主要负责以下几个关键功能: 1. **模型(Models)**:定义数据模型,用于存储问卷、问题、选项等信息。 2. **视图(Views)**:处理HTTP请求,返回相应的HTTP响应,如渲染问卷页面、处理提交的问卷数据。 3. **模板(Templates)**:提供HTML模版,用于展示问卷内容和结果。 4. **URL路由(URL Routing)**:将用户请求映射到对应的视图函数。 **Vue.js** 是一种轻量级的前端JavaScript框架,它以组件化的方式构建用户界面。在问卷系统中,Vue.js的角色包括: 1. **动态渲染**:实时更新问卷界面,如根据用户选择动态显示或隐藏问题。 2. **表单处理**:监听用户输入,验证数据,并在客户端预处理问卷数据。 3. **API交互**:通过Ajax与Django后端进行数据交换,如获取问卷列表、提交问卷答案。 **核心功能实现**: 1. **问卷创建**:用户可以创建包含各种题型(如单选、多选、填空等)的问卷。 2. **发布与分享**:发布问卷后,生成问卷链接,用户可以通过社交媒体或邮件等方式分享。 3. **答题界面**:用户根据问卷链接进入答题页面,填写并提交答案。 4. **数据收集**:Django后端收集并存储所有提交的答案数据。 5. **数据分析**:后台提供统计和分析功能,如查看回答分布、导出报告。 **技术栈其他部分**: - **db.sqlite3**:这是Django默认使用的SQLite数据库文件,用于存储问卷系统的所有数据。 - **.idea**:可能是使用PyCharm或其他IDE的工作区配置文件,包含了项目的设置和结构信息。 - **Qnaire**:可能是一个包含问卷系统源代码的目录。 - **.git**:版本控制文件,表明项目使用Git进行版本管理和协作。 Django+Vue问卷系统结合了Django的强大后端处理能力和Vue.js的高效前端渲染技术,实现了在线问卷调查的基本流程。它为用户提供了一个便捷的创建、发布和收集问卷平台。尽管在题型上可能不如专业问卷平台丰富,但对于学习和实践Django与Vue.js的结合应用来说,这是一个很好的示例项目。
  • Spring BootVueJava前后端分离SQL
    优质
    本资源提供Spring Boot框架搭配Vue.js实现的Java前后端分离项目的完整SQL脚本文件,涵盖数据库设计、表结构及初始数据等内容。 Java 之 Spring Boot + Vue 前后端分离项目 SQL 文件
  • SpringBootVue框架zip
    优质
    这是一个包含Spring Boot和Vue.js技术栈的项目压缩包。此项目集成了Java后端服务和前端单页面应用,旨在快速搭建前后端分离的Web应用程序。 SpringBoot与Vue框架结合的项目代码简洁、优秀,并且注释清晰详细,可以直接进行二次开发。欢迎各位程序员共同参与,一起努力进步!
  • SpringBootVue管理模板
    优质
    本项目提供了一个基于Spring Boot和Vue.js技术栈的高效项目管理解决方案。通过前后端分离架构,实现灵活的任务分配、进度跟踪及团队协作功能,助力提升开发效率。 管理项目模板采用Spring Boot与Vue框架结合的方式进行开发。这种组合能够提供高效、灵活的解决方案,适用于构建现代化的Web应用程序。通过利用Spring Boot的强大后端支持以及Vue前端框架的响应式界面设计能力,可以轻松地创建和维护复杂的业务逻辑,并且为用户提供更加流畅友好的交互体验。 该模板旨在简化项目启动过程,加快开发速度并提高代码质量。开发者可以从预设的功能模块中选择需要的部分进行快速集成,同时也可以根据具体需求对现有功能进行自定义修改或扩展新特性。 此外,在团队协作方面也具有明显优势:清晰的结构有助于促进成员之间的沟通与合作;良好的文档支持和详细的注释可以降低新人上手难度以及维护成本。总之,这样的项目模板为开发者提供了便捷高效的开发工具,助力实现高效敏捷的产品交付流程。
  • VueDjango部署详解
    优质
    本书详细讲解了如何将基于Vue和Django框架开发的Web应用进行部署,涵盖从环境配置到线上发布的全过程。 Vue+Django项目的部署包含多个步骤,包括本地项目配置、前端构建、服务器环境准备及数据库设置等环节。 在进行本地项目配置阶段,需要为生产环境创建一个`prop.py`文件,并从开发环境的`dev.py`中继承相关配置。你需要在新配置文件里指定允许访问的应用域名(如api.youdomain.com),并设定跨域策略白名单以涵盖前端与后端应用的域名。对于涉及第三方服务,例如支付宝等项目,还需设置相应的应用ID、通知URL以及其它必要参数。 接着更新`wsgi.py`和`manage.py`文件,确保它们指向新的生产环境配置。使用命令`pip freeze > requirements.txt`来生成一个包含所有依赖项的文本段落件。执行Django静态文件收集命令 `python manage.py collectstatic`,以便在生产环境中正确应用这些资源。 对于前端部分,在Vue项目的设置中需要指定后端API服务器的相关信息(如域名和端口)。然后使用`npm run build`构建前端项目,并将结果提交到Git仓库。 部署至服务器时,首先安装必要的软件包:Python、pip、virtualenv、nginx、gcc以及uWSGI。假设数据库为MySQL,则需先安装MySQL Server并创建及导入数据表结构与内容;如果需要使用Redis作为缓存或消息队列服务,同样要进行相应设置。 在服务器上从Git仓库克隆前端和后端代码,并构建Vue项目以生成静态文件(如HTML、JS等),然后将其部署到指定目录。对于Django应用,则创建虚拟环境并安装`requirements.txt`中列出的依赖项;接着配置nginx作为反向代理,将请求转发给uWSGI服务进程来处理。 启动所有必要的后台和服务(例如uWSGI和nginx)后,Vue+Django项目便部署成功了。在整个过程中应注意保护敏感信息的安全性,并定期更新相关软件以确保系统的稳定性和安全性。此外,可以考虑使用环境变量管理工具存储敏感数据,防止这些信息被直接写入代码仓库中。 总结来说,部署一个结合Vue和Django的项目涉及多方面的技术细节,包括前端与后端构建、服务器配置及数据库操作等环节。掌握并理解这些步骤有助于提高项目的部署效率以及后续维护工作的便利性。
  • Vue完整ZIP
    优质
    这是一个包含完整Vue.js项目结构和源代码的压缩包,适合初学者学习或作为小型应用快速搭建的基础模板。 vue完整项目已实现,可满足上岗web前端的需求。该项目包括接口文档和详细步骤说明,并且已经展示了完成后的页面情况。极个别编辑和删除功能较为简单尚未编写。 这样表述既保留了原意又去除了不必要的链接信息。